Uruguay - Agricultural Raw Materials Exports
Since 2014, Uruguay Agricultural Raw Materials Exports jumped by 8points year on year. At 15 Percent of Goods Exports in 2019, the country was number 8 comparing other countries in Agricultural Raw Materials Exports. Uruguay is overtaken by Afghanistan, which was ranked number 7 with 17.79 Percent of Goods Exports and is followed by Kenya at 12.49 Percent of Goods Exports. Solomon Islands topped the ranking with 72.45 Percent of Goods Exports in 2019, a decrease of 1.2points compared to 2018. Benin, Gambia and East Timor resp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Maldives witnessed the best average annual growth at +394.4points per year, while Yemen witnessed the worst performance at -51.6points per year.
Date | Percent of Goods Exports |
---|---|
2019 | 15.00 |
2018 | 17.51 |
2017 | 14.69 |
2016 | 14.35 |
2015 | 13.48 |
